Summary:
The Downers Grove GSD 58 district in Illinois consists of 13 schools, including 11 elementary schools and 2 middle schools, serving students from pre-kindergarten through 8th grade. The district is highly ranked, placing 91st out of 811 districts in the state and earning a 4-out-of-5-star rating from SchoolDigger.
Within the district, a few schools stand out as top performers. Hillcrest Elementary School is the highest-ranked, placing 28th out of 2,056 elementary schools in Illinois and earning a perfect 5-out-of-5-star rating. It boasts exceptional test scores, with 87.3% of students proficient or better in English Language Arts and 82% in Mathematics. Fairmount Elementary School and Belle Aire Elementary School also rank among the top 79 elementary schools in the state and earn 5-star ratings, with strong proficiency rates across core subjects.
While the district as a whole performs well above state averages, with 76.3% proficiency in English Language Arts and 66.4% in Mathematics, the middle schools show higher rates of free and reduced-price lunch eligibility compared to the elementary schools. Additionally, the district faces a chronic absenteeism rate of 25.4%, which is an area for potential improvement. Overall, the Downers Grove GSD 58 district appears to be a high-performing system, with several standout schools and consistent academic excellence across the majority of its institutions.
